jjzjj

whitespaces

全部标签

ios - NSString 为每 4 个字符附加 WhiteSpace

我有一个像@"1234123412341234"这样的字符串,我需要在每4个字符之间附加空格。@"1234123412341234"即,我需要像Visa卡类型这样的NSString。我试过这样但我没有得到我的结果。-(void)resetCardNumberAsVisa:(NSString*)aNumber{NSMutableString*s=[aNumbermutableCopy];for(intp=0;p 最佳答案 这是一个unicode感知实现,作为NSString上的一个类别:@interfaceNSString(NRStr

php - Laravel 5.2 artisan 优化 - php_strip_whitespace 无法打开流 : No child processes

自从从Laravel5.1升级到Laravel5.2后,在CircleCI上运行artisanoptimize时,运行PHP5.6.14,我得到了[ErrorException]php_strip_whitespace(/var/laravel/project/root):failedtoopenstream:Nochildprocesses其中/var/laravel/project/root是composer.json和vendor所在的目录。该命令在我运行PHP5.6.11-1ubuntu3.1的开发箱上运行良好。我遵循了官方的5.1到5.2升级指南。Exceptiontrace

android - 在 Android Studio :Whitespaces in directory location 中更改 SDK 位置

我正在使用androidAPI级别22。但是这个位置是从另一台机器复制的,它在我的E:驱动器中。我在以下位置安装了API级别23:C:\ProgramFiles(x86)\Android\android-sdk但是当我尝试将位置更改为上述位置时,我收到以下消息:AndroidSDKlocationshouldnotcontainwhitespace,asthiscancauseproblemwiththenativetools.如何在不出现空格问题的情况下将SDK位置更改为上述位置。 最佳答案 这是我解决这个问题的方法。无需重新定位

PHP - HTTP header 中的文件名 : Problem with whitespaces

使用CakePHP和JavaWebStart我在Controller中生成必要的.jnlp文件,其中我将文件名设置为标题字段。只要我不尝试在文件名中使用特殊字符,它就可以正常工作。但是,我想在主要操作系统上启用每个可能的字符作为文件名。所以我尝试做的是通过用空字符串替换它们来删除所有无效字符。但是文件名中应该允许的空格似乎存在问题。这是代码:$panel_id=1$panelname='whitespaces';$filename=sprintf('"Project_%d_%s.jnlp"',$panel_id,$panelname);$invalid_chars=array('','

php - 解析错误 : syntax error, 意外 '' (T_ENCAPSED_AND_WHITESPACE)

这个问题在这里已经有了答案:Reference-WhatdoesthiserrormeaninPHP?(38个答案)关闭9年前。FullError:Parseerror:syntaxerror,unexpected''(T_ENCAPSED_AND_WHITESPACE),expectingidentifier(T_STRING)orvariable(T_VARIABLE)ornumber(T_NUM_STRING)它说错误在第12行。这是我那里的内容:$introduction="INSERTINTOIntroduction(Title,Description)VALUES('$_P

python - 只是分心 : tokenizing English without whitespaces. Murakami SheepMan

我想知道如果删除空格,您将如何对英语(或其他西方语言)的字符串进行分词?问题的灵感来自于村上小说中的羊人角色'DanceDanceDance'在小说中,羊人被翻译成这样的话:"likewesaid,we'lldowhatwecan.Trytoreconnectyou,towhatyouwant,"saidtheSheepMan."Butwecan'tdoit-alone.Yougottaworktoo."因此,保留了一些标点符号,但不是全部。足以供人类阅读,但有些武断。您为此构建解析器的策略是什么?字母的常见组合、音节数、条件语法、前视/后视正则表达式等?具体来说,在Python方面,

python - Textmate Whitespace/Invisibles - 显示空格

有没有办法在TextMate中显示“软标签”(空格)?View→ShowInvisibles如果您使用制表符进行缩进,则可以很好地跟踪缩进。不幸的是,在缩进是语义化的语言中,您通常必须使用空格。(Python、YAML、HAML、CoffeeScript)对于在TextMate中显示此空白或跟踪软缩进有什么建议吗?我应该继续坚持使用Textmate2吗?也欢迎其他策略和建议。 最佳答案 latestversion启用ShowInvisibles时,TextMate2会突出显示空格。编辑:您甚至可以通过修改.tm_properties

css - 删除 div 元素之间的 "whitespace"

这是我的HTML代码我的CSS:#div1{width:150px;height:100px;white-space:nowrap;border:blue1pxsolid;padding:5px;}#div1div{width:30px;height:30px;border:blue1pxsolid;display:inline-block;*display:inline;zoom:1;margin:0px;outline:none;}如果我插入在之前标记,页面将如下所示:但是如果我删除标签,两行之间的“空白”将被删除但我想使用标记,这是推荐的,但我找不到任何可以删除该空格的CSS规则

git:使用 "commit --cleanup=whitespace"和 "rebase --interactive"

我想在创建/编辑提交消息时始终使用--cleanup=whitespace(以允许初始“#”)。不幸的是,我找不到合适的设置来放入~/.gitconfig;这个不行:[commit]cleanup=whitespace对于正常提交,我将--cleanup=whitespace添加到我的主要提交别名中,但是我不知道如何将此选项传递给gitrebase--interactive以便我可以改写和压缩提交并使用我喜欢的清理方法。 最佳答案 在git1.8.2他们添加了我尝试使用的设置:"gitcommit"canbetoldtouse--c

git - 打补丁时 "1 line adds whitespace errors"是什么意思?

我正在编辑克隆的远程存储库的一些Markdown文件,并且想测试创建补丁并将补丁从一个分支应用到另一个分支。但是,每次我进行任何更改时,我都会在gitapply期间收到以下消息:0001-b.patch:16:trailingwhitespace.warning:1lineaddswhitespaceerrors.(这发生在我的Mac上,我不知道原始代码是在哪里创建的。)警告信息是什么意思,我需要注意吗? 最佳答案 你不需要关心。警告制定了文本文件关于空白的清洁标准,这是许多程序员往往关心的事情。作为themanual解释:What